Recipe for Chocolate Chip Cookies
A choc chip cookies recipe that's been handed down and around for years.

Servings: 20 cookies
Calories: 150kcal
- 125 grams butter
- ½ cup caster sugar (or granulated sugar)
- ½ cup brown sugar
- 1 egg
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 ¾ cups SR flour (or 1 ¾ cups plain/all-purpose flour and 3 teaspoons baking powder and a pinch of salt)
- ¾ cups chocolate chips milk, dark or white (or 125 grams roughly chopped chocolate)
Pre-heat oven to moderate (180 degrees celsius, fan-forced).
Line three baking trays with baking paper.
Cream butter and sugar until pale and fluffy.
Add lightly whisked egg and vanilla extract and beat again until well combined.
Fold in flour gradually, and then stir in chocolate chips until evenly distributed throughout mixture. (But don't overmix!)
Roll tablespoons into balls and place on baking tray, spaced to allow for spreading. Flatten balls slightly with your fingertips.
Bake for 13-15 minutes.
Allow to cool for a few minutes on the baking tray and then use a spatula to transfer to a cooling tray.
Store in an airtight container.
